Sellers traditionally included the two real estate agent commissions — their unique and the customer’s. But that altered in 2024, and now, Just about every party might (or might not) be answerable for paying out only their unique agent. The main points of each transaction will be distinct, and will be negotiated in advance of time.
Commissions and fees have normally been negotiable, but ahead of the NAR commission lawsuit, sellers as well as their agents mainly decided commission rates. Now, both of those customers and sellers ought to indicator listing agreements with their agents that clarifies their commission rates, which may really encourage extra customers to barter fees.
